TPWallet连接BSC(Bcs)连接不上?从防中间人攻击到链上计算的全方位排查与前景展望

以下内容用于“TPWallet连接不上BCS(或BSC/BCS相关链路)”的排查与体系化说明,并扩展到防中间人攻击、高效能数字技术、市场前景、全球化智能支付服务、链上计算与数据管理等话题。注意:不同项目/钱包对“BCS”的具体含义可能不同(例如有人用“bcs”指代BSC/BCS生态或自定义RPC网络)。建议在实际操作中以你钱包里配置的网络名称与链ID为准。

一、先明确问题:TPWallet“连接不上”到底卡在哪里

1)连接层问题(RPC/网络)

- 常见现象:钱包无法拉取区块高度、无法查询账户余额、发起请求超时。

- 需要确认:你当前选择的网络(Network)是否真的对应BCS/目标链;RPC地址是否可用;是否被运营商/地区网络拦截。

2)签名与链交互问题(ChainId/合约/路由)

- 常见现象:能连接RPC,但交易失败、签名被拒、显示“chain mismatch”“invalid chainId”等。

- 需要确认:链ID(chainId)与地址派生规则是否匹配;合约地址是否存在于该链;代币合约是否已在该网络部署。

3)安全与防欺骗问题(握手/证书/中间人风险)

- 常见现象:频繁报错、错误的交易回显、RPC响应异常。

- 需要强调:高质量钱包通常会做请求完整性校验与反欺骗策略。若你把RPC改成不可信来源,即便“看起来能连”,也可能遭遇中间人攻击。

二、防中间人攻击:从“可连接”到“可信连接”的关键做法

当TPWallet连不上或你更换网络时,最该优先关注的是“连接的可信性”。可用以下思路做防中间人攻击(MITM)与钓鱼规避:

1)只使用可信RPC来源

- 优先使用项目官方公告的RPC/节点列表。

- 不要随意从群聊、网页、链接中复制“看似有效”的RPC。

- 若必须自建/第三方RPC,应做连通性与一致性验证(见下)。

2)做一致性验证(轻量校验)

- 同一时间用两个或多个可信节点对比:

- 区块高度是否一致(在合理时间窗内)。

- 常用账户/代币余额查询结果是否一致。

- 最新区块哈希是否合理。

- 若差异巨大或结果“时有时无”,要警惕节点篡改或网络劫持。

3)使用加密传输与证书校验

- 选择支持HTTPS/WSS的RPC端点(视钱包实现而定)。

- 避免HTTP明文RPC;明文更易被局部网络篡改或注入。

4)签名域与链ID校验

- 对签名类交互,确认钱包对EIP-155 chainId校验严格。

- 当你看到“链切换/网络不匹配”提示时,不要强行绕过。

5)警惕“连接成功但交易异常”

- MITM或假节点常见特征:RPC能返回一些数据,但交易广播/回执异常。

- 典型信号包括:交易状态一直pending、回执字段异常、gas估算离谱。

三、高效能数字技术:提升连接成功率与交互体验

“连接不上”有时并非安全问题,而是工程问题:延迟、吞吐、节点拥塞、路由不稳定。高效能数字技术的方向包括:

1)多节点冗余与自动故障切换

- 钱包或客户端应提供多RPC列表。

- 当主节点超时,自动切换到备选节点,并记录可用性指标。

2)请求批处理与缓存

- 查询余额、nonce、代币列表等可采用批处理(Batch)或本地缓存。

- 对不频繁变化的数据(例如代币元数据)可做短周期缓存,减少RPC压力。

3)速率限制与指数退避(Backoff)

- 对超时/429等限流错误使用指数退避,避免“疯狂重试”导致更拥堵。

4)本地链状态快速推断

- 若钱包实现了轻客户端索引:可以从上次状态或本地索引快速恢复页面,减少冷启动等待。

四、市场前景:为什么BSC/BCS生态连接体验会成为竞争点

在跨链与多链时代,“钱包连不上”的体验损失非常直接:

- 用户流失:用户会迅速转向可用性更高的钱包或更快的RPC。

- 交易成本上升:连接失败导致重试、延迟与gas浪费。

- 生态信任受损:若多数用户在某链段遇到连接问题,资产与应用的增长会受影响。

因此,提升连接稳定性与安全性,实际上是竞争护城河的一部分。市场上对“低门槛、安全、快速到账”的需求持续存在,钱包与基础设施(节点、RPC、索引服务)将长期受益。

五、全球化智能支付服务:从链上转账到支付网络

当谈“全球化智能支付服务”时,可以把区块链钱包理解为支付网络的客户端入口:

1)跨境结算与更低摩擦

- 用户可用本地时区操作、减少跨境中间环节。

- 链上结算可降低部分传统清算成本。

2)多资产与可编程支付

- 智能合约可实现:分账、条件支付、自动退款、限额与风控。

- 支付不只是一笔转账,还可以是“可验证的资金流程”。

3)可扩展的合约与路由

- 对不同链上资产(代币/稳定币/桥资产),需要良好的路由与统一的资产展示。

- 当TPWallet连接对应链稳定后,用户体验会更接近“电商式”的即时支付。

六、链上计算:让“连接”变成可自动化的服务

链上计算并不只服务于DeFi,它也能嵌入支付、风控与对账:

1)链上执行与状态机

- 支付、结算、清算都可以由智能合约状态机驱动。

- “连接不上”如果改善,交易与状态同步会更可靠。

2)自动化清结算

- 通过链上事件触发:到款确认、自动发货、或自动对账。

3)可信执行与审计

- 链上计算的可审计特性使得支付与结算过程更透明。

七、数据管理:连接、索引与隐私的统一治理

数据管理是钱包与基础设施的底座,关乎稳定性、性能与合规:

1)链上数据索引与缓存策略

- 对账户余额、代币转账、事件日志做索引。

- 索引可由专门的Indexer服务提供,钱包只需稳定读取。

2)一致性与回滚处理

- 链上存在重组(reorg)风险或节点同步延迟。

- 数据管理层要有“确认数/最终性”策略,避免过早展示错误状态。

3)隐私与最小披露

- 钱包应尽量减少不必要的链上查询和请求暴露。

- 对用户地址与交互行为应注意最小化日志与权限。

4)监控与可观测性(Observability)

- 监控RPC延迟、错误率、区块同步速度。

- 当用户报告“连接不上”,可以快速定位是节点、网络、还是配置错误。

八、给你一个可执行的排查清单(建议按顺序)

1)确认网络:TPWallet里选择的网络是否确实是BCS/目标链;核对chainId是否一致。

2)确认RPC:使用官方或可靠节点;优先HTTPS/WSS;不要随意替换为来历不明RPC。

3)测试连通:在同一网络下尝试查询区块高度、余额、交易历史(若可)。

4)对比一致性:同样请求换一个可靠RPC做对照,观察返回是否一致。

5)检查签名/交易:如能连接但交易失败,重点看chainId、代币合约地址、gas设置。

6)网络环境:更换网络(手机流量/家庭宽带/不同地区节点);检查是否被拦截或DNS劫持。

7)升级与重试策略:更新TPWallet版本;不要无节制重试,必要时等待节点同步。

九、结语:连接问题不只是“能不能用”,而是安全、性能与数据能力的综合体现

当TPWallet连接不上BCS时,既可能是网络与配置层的问题,也可能涉及安全可信度、节点质量与数据索引能力。面向长期发展,防中间人攻击、追求高效能数字技术、布局全球化智能支付服务、加强链上计算与数据管理,将共同决定用户体验与生态增长。

(如你愿意,告诉我:你钱包里选择的“BCS”具体网络名称/链ID、你使用的RPC来源、报错截图或文字、以及你要连接/发起的具体操作:查询余额还是发起转账。我可以据此给更精准的逐项定位。)

作者:清风与账本发布时间:2026-06-05 06:31:24

评论

LinaZhao

写得很系统!尤其是“一致性验证”这点,能有效降低假RPC/中间人风险。

Noah_Chen

从连接层到签名校验的拆解很实用。希望后续再补一个针对具体错误码的对照表。

MiaWang

链上计算和数据管理的部分衔接得不错,能把“钱包体验”上升到基础设施竞争。

KevinLi

全球化智能支付那段让我有共鸣:稳定连接确实是支付规模化的前提。

SunnyK

高效能数字技术讲到缓存和批处理很关键,解决“不但连上还要快”。

小雨点

建议排查清单按步骤走,避免盲目换RPC。整体逻辑清晰,收藏了。

相关阅读